About STARPAK files

A .starpak file is a proprietary game resource archive used exclusively by Respawn Entertainment for titles like Apex Legends and Titanfall 2. These files store massive streams of game data, primarily focusing on high-resolution textures, audio clips, and 3D mesh data required for seamless in-game environments.

The game engines naturally read these files during gameplay to stream assets on the fly. Because these files are highly specific to Respawn's heavily modified Source Engine, community developers and modders have built specialized extraction tools, such as the open-source Legion extractor, to unpack them for data-mining, fan art, or custom modding.

The .starpak format is incredibly restricted and optimized strictly for the game engine. Users cannot open it with standard archive utilities like WinRAR or 7-Zip. The files are heavily compressed, often reaching tens of gigabytes in size, and sometimes utilize strict internal file structures or encryption. This prevents casual users from accessing game textures or voice lines directly, requiring complicated third-party scripts to access the contents.

Converting a .starpak directly into a standard archive format like ZIP or an audio format like MP3 is impossible without proper extraction. Users typically need to extract the raw contents first. Target formats for these extracted assets include PNG or DDS for 3D textures, and WAV or OGG for audio files.

Because this is a closed, proprietary format, standard online converters completely fail to process it. Often, only specialized, reverse-engineered community tools can properly read or export the underlying data.
